Bulletin No.: 19-NA-095
Date: May, 2019
Service Bulletin
INFORMATION
Subject: Information on Metric Fuel Consumption Display Inaccurate at Times in the Energy Display
Brand: | Model: | Model Year: | VIN: | Engine: | Electric Drive Unit: | |||
from | to | from | to | |||||
Chevrolet | Volt | 2019 | 2019 | 1.5L (L3A) | 5ET50 (MKV) |
Involved Region or Country | North America and N.A. Export Regions |
Condition | 5329244
Energy Summary Pop-up at Key-off 5329250 Energy Display from Leaf Menu Some customers may comment that when the vehicle display is set to metric units of measure, most often seen in Canada, the energy display on the center screen will show 0.2 L / 100 km when no fuel has been consumed. The display can also be configured such that the energy summary pops-up on the center screen for 10 seconds at key-off, making the issue more visible. 5329253 The fuel consumption value will reset every time the battery is fully charged. The instrument cluster display will correctly show an average 0.0 L / 100 km for Trip1 or Trip2 if the trip data is reset during electric vehicle operation. |
Cause | The 2019 Volt has a unit conversion error that affects the metric display. Once fuel starts to be consumed, the conversion will work properly.
The condition only affects the zero fuel used state, which can be common during electric only operation. |
Correction | This is considered a normal vehicle operating characteristic and no software solution is planned at this time. Neither programming, nor part replacement will correct the condition.
Please share this information with the customer, including a copy of this bulletin. |
